Cuvat is a small commune located in the Auvergne-Rhône-Alpes region of southeastern France. Its GPS coordinates are 45.97592° N latitude and 6.11835° E longitude, placing it near the city of Annecy and the surrounding natural beauty of the French Alps. Cuvat is known for its picturesque landscapes and proximity to outdoor recreational activities, making it a desirable location for nature enthusiasts seeking tranquility away from urban centers.
The commune falls within the Europe/Paris timezone, aligning it with the majority of France for timekeeping purposes. Regionally, Cuvat’s significance lies in its accessibility to larger cities like Annecy and Geneva, Switzerland, enhancing its appeal for residents and visitors who appreciate both rural charm and urban conveniences.
Timezone in Cuvat
Cuvat is located in the Europe/Paris timezone, which operates on a UTC offset of +1 during standard time. When daylight saving time is in effect, the offset changes to UTC +2. Daylight saving time in Cuvat begins on the last Sunday in March and ends on the last Sunday in October, meaning clocks are set forward one hour in spring and set back one hour in autumn.
